TUESDAY, MARCH 13, 1990 <br /> <br /> of Kings Row a couple of. years ago was that right-of-way be provided for a <br /> <br />=.turnaround at the end of the street. There was apparently no commitment to the <br /> actual construction of a turnaround at that time. ,Vice-Mayor Williams had <br /> inquired as to the status of this turnaround after he had been questioned by <br /> residents of the area. <br /> <br />City Manager Brown introduced Mr. Lance Heater, Assistant to the City Manager, <br /> <br />.and welcomed him to the City. <br /> <br />The following comments were made by various Councilmen: <br /> <br />Councilman McClain inquired about the traffic light at Church and <br />Brookdale Streets accommodating left turns onto Brookdale from <br />Church while traveling west. Leon Towarnicki, Director of Public <br />Works, noted they would get to it in a few weeks, after installa- <br />tion of the light at Market Street mid Commonwealth Boulevard.- <br /> <br /> Councilmm~ McClain inquired about a center turn laneon Market <br /> Street at Bridge Street. Leon Towarnicki stated they would be <br />· drawing up plans to see if it was feasible <br /> <br /> C. Councilman McClain inquired about various violations of the City <br /> Code related to junk cars, debris, etc. City Manager Brown stated <br /> that the responsibility for enforcement of the Code related to <br /> these matters has been assigned to one individual so we can keep <br />.~ up;with repeat offenders and deal with them appropriately. ~. <br /> <br />Councilman Cole inquired as to some demolition and .clearing of <br />lots at the corner of Parkview and Spruce Street. It was noted <br />that this work was done by Lanier Farms to improve their property <br />to make it more marketable. <br /> <br />In accordance with Section 2.1-344(A) of the CODE OF VIRGINIA (1950, and as <br /> <br />amended), m~d upon motion, duly seconded and carried by a unanimous recorded <br /> <br />vote', Council convened into an Executive Session for the purpose of considering <br />(A) an appointment to the Martinsville Transportation Safety Commission, as <br />authorized by Subsection 1; (B) an appointment to the Piedmont Emergency Medi- <br />cal Services Council, as authorized by Subsection 1; and (C) a personnel matter <br /> <br /> <br />
